Similar story, different night.  Like a Shakespearean drama, the same themes play out over and over. 

Watching these games has become like watching Tuesday night open gym at the Y.  Out shot. Out rebounded.  Out hustled.  Out defensed.  Out coached.  At least we have a better looking warm up routine.

14 O rebounds for Averett after 16 to NCW.  17 turnovers.  We just don't learn.  Once again, we played the short lineup almost 70% of the minutes.  Big Mark on the floor for only 21 minutes.  At one point, we didn't have a single shooter in the game.

Torched by quick guards again.  Matador defense by ours.  Third straight 90 point defensive effort after not giving up 90 points all season.

Dependence on a perimeter passing offense resulting in ill advised and low percentage 3 shots.  10 missed foul shots.  No timeout to set up a play when down by 2 at the end.

One on one play.  Conley had a career game but let's be serious.  35 points and 0 assists from a guard.  That goes with 25 points and 1 assist last game.  Conley took 17 shots last night.  The next Captain took 8.  I guess we shouldn't worry about any double-doubles from Conley anytime soon.  Kobe leads the Lakers in both points and assists per game.  Everyone in the gym knows that Conley is going to drive the baseline when he gets the pass.  Good players get everyone involved.

Bad attitudes.  Mouthing off at the coaches.  Pouting on the bench by seasoned players when the player gets yanked.  Playing time is not an entitlement.  Don't confuse experience and effort with results.  It's all very disappointing for the loyal fans that do show up to every home game.

Here is how it stands now -

N.C. Wesleyan 8-1  12-9
Shenandoah 6-3  9-13
Averett 6-4  9-13
Chris. Newport 4-5  9-12
Ferrum 4-6  10-13
Methodist 2-6  2-19
Greensboro 2-7  9-13

It would be MUCH better to be the 3rd seed instead of the 4th.  I would like to put off playing the Bishops as long as possible.  That means that CNU must overtake Averett, which at first glance seems impossible since Averett would get the tie-breaker because of their sweep of the Captains.  So, that means that CNU must win out and Averett must lose their last 2.  Actually, that could happen.  CNU plays the 3 teams at the bottom of the standings and Averett plays the two teams at the very top.  They get NCW at home but have to play at Shenandoah.  From my perspective, that's perfect.  Bishops might be able to beat them on the road and the Hornets could defend their home court. 

That is a lot of "ifs" but there is still a chance to get the 3rd seed.  Of course, we could slip back to the 5th seed also and have to play on the road to open the tournament, but there is a good chance for us to win out, AND for Averett to lose their last two.  If that happens I am VERY confident that the Hornets couldn't beat the Captains a 3rd time this year, especially again at the Freeman.  That puts CNU in the championship game (at home), and who knows what would happen if CNU is on a 5 game win streak.
